| 1 | These files are from the large example of using the `parser' module. Refer
|
|---|
| 2 | to the Python Library Reference for more information.
|
|---|
| 3 |
|
|---|
| 4 | It also contains examples for the AST parser.
|
|---|
| 5 |
|
|---|
| 6 | Files:
|
|---|
| 7 | ------
|
|---|
| 8 |
|
|---|
| 9 | FILES -- list of files associated with the parser module.
|
|---|
| 10 |
|
|---|
| 11 | README -- this file.
|
|---|
| 12 |
|
|---|
| 13 | docstring.py -- sample source file containing only a module docstring.
|
|---|
| 14 |
|
|---|
| 15 | example.py -- module that uses the `parser' module to extract
|
|---|
| 16 | information from the parse tree of Python source
|
|---|
| 17 | code.
|
|---|
| 18 |
|
|---|
| 19 | simple.py -- sample source containing a "short form" definition.
|
|---|
| 20 |
|
|---|
| 21 | source.py -- sample source code used to demonstrate ability to
|
|---|
| 22 | handle nested constructs easily using the functions
|
|---|
| 23 | and classes in example.py.
|
|---|
| 24 |
|
|---|
| 25 | test_parser.py program to put the parser module through its paces.
|
|---|
| 26 |
|
|---|
| 27 | test_unparse.py tests for the unparse module
|
|---|
| 28 |
|
|---|
| 29 | unparse.py AST (2.7) based example to recreate source code
|
|---|
| 30 | from an AST.
